How they compare
Cayman Islands currently reports 18.13 million BoP, current US$ against 15.16 million BoP, current US$ in Brunei Darussalam, a difference of 2.98 million BoP, current US$.
That makes Cayman Islands's figure about 1.2 times Brunei Darussalam's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 9 shared years of data; in 2016 it was Cayman Islands ahead.
Brunei Darussalam ranks 145th and Cayman Islands ranks 142nd of 189 countries.
Cayman Islands has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

About this data
Information and communication technology service exports include computer and communications services (telecommunications and postal and courier services) and information services (computer data and news-related service transactions). Data are in current U.S. dollars.
